    Q:
    What components need to be removed to access the headlight dimmer switch for the 2006 Toyota RAV4? Posted by Customer
    A:
    Remove the steering pad assembly, steering wheel assembly, steering column cover, spiral cable sub-assembly, and wiper and washer switch.

    Q:
    What components need to be removed after disconnecting the battery for the 2005 Toyota Prius? Posted by Customer
    A:
    Remove the steering wheel cover lower No.2 and lower No.3, followed by the horn button assembly and the steering wheel assembly using Special Service Tool: 09950-50013 (09951-05010, 09952-05010, 09953-05020, 09954-05021).

    Q:
    What components need to be removed to access the headlight dimmer switch assembly for the 2006 Toyota Prius? Posted by Customer
    A:
    Remove the No. 2 and No. 3 steering wheel cover lower, the steering pad assembly, the steering wheel assembly, the steering column cover, the spiral cable sub-assembly, and the wiper and washer switch assembly.
